2. Transmission projects already awarded to the successful bidders through the Power Finance Corporation (PFC) and Rural Electrification Corporation (REC) as the Bid Process Coordinators (BPC): A. Power Finance Corporation:
S. No. Name of the Project Purpose of the project i) Scheme for Enabling Import of NER/ER surplus by NR. a) Bongaigaon-Siliguri 400 kV D/C Quad line 260 km b) Purnea-Biharsharif 400 kV D/C Quad line 235 km Transfer of surplus power from upcoming projects in North-Eastern Region (NER) and Sikkim to Northern Region. ii) System strengthening common for WR and NR a) Dharamjaygarh-Jabalpur 765 kV D/C line 350 km b) Jabalpur pool Bina 765 kV S/C line 250 km Transfer of power from various Independent Power Producers (IPPs) in Jharkhand and West Bengal and Moser Bear IPP to beneficiaries in Northern Region and Western Region iii) System Strengthening for WR a) Jabalpur-Bhopal 765 kV S/C line - 330 ckm b) Bhopal-Indore 765 kV S/C line -180 km c) 765/400 kV, 2x1500 MVA substation at Bhopal d) Bhopal-Bhopal (MPPTCL) 400 kV D/C Quad line 40 km e) Aurangabad-Dhule 765 kV S/C line 150 km f) Dhule-Vadodara 765kV S/C line 250 km g) 765/400 kV, 2x1500 MVA Dhule(IPTC) substation. h) Dhule (IPTC)- Dhule(MSETCL) 400 kV D/C Quad 40 km Transfer of power from various up coming IPPs in Orissa and Chhattisgrah to Western Region beneficiaries.
